I have an LS421DE which is now not accessible, on checking the status I see both drives have failed within 15 minutes of each other.

Error:
E:30 Drive 1 error, replace the drive immediately! (2019/11/11 13:57:28 )
E:30 Drive 2 error, replace the drive immediately! (2019/11/11 13:42:52 )

Status:
I12: The raid is in degraded mode.


https://www.buffalotech.com/images/product_images/LS421DE_Datasheet.pdf

Do I really need to replace both drives? As both have the error what are the chances of a full recovery?  Or is this more likely an issue with the NAS hardware itself?

Thanks in advance.

mf9

I've isolated my issue to a faulty power supply block, as using another one from my other NAS has got me gong again, right now I resolving a corrupted firmware.  Does anyone know where I can get a replacement power cable and brick from?

1000001101000

That makes sense.

I've had good luck with all the 12v 4a adapters I've tried,
